Philly’s Finest

May 3, 2019 By Michael Fitzgerald Leave a Comment

1601 Rhode Island Ave., NE

-1986-

Room capacity of 65.

Formerly Mr. Y's.

Artists

  • Mary Jefferson (1986)
  • Orrington Hall (1986)
  • Major Gee (1986)
  • Eddie Hayter (1986)
  • Butch Warren (1986)
  • Joe Jackson (1986)
  • Malachi Thompson (1986)
  • Carter Jefferson (1986)
  • Houston Person (1986)
  • Etta Jones (1986)
  • Billy James (1986)

Bibliography

7756 {40596:ELGHP9FD} items 1 chicago-fullnote-bibliography author asc https://jazzmf.com/wp/wp-content/plugins/zotpress/
Piantadosi, Roger. “All That Jazz: The Music Stayed Cool, So It’s Hotter Than Ever.” Washington Post, August 22, 1986.
